Declan Ryan Confirmed As New Tipp Hurling Boss

Declan Ryan has been confirmed as the new Tipperary senior hurling manager (INPHO)

Declan Ryan has been confirmed as the new Tipperary senior hurling manager after the Tipperary County Board released a statement following their recent board meeting.

The statement reads: "Tipperary County Board tonight approved the appointment for a two-year term of Declan Ryan (Clonoulty Rossmore) as manager of the Tipperary senior hurling team, Tommy Dunne (Toomevara) as coach and Michael Gleeson (Thurles Sarsfields) as selector. Tipperary County Board wishes Declan, Tommy, and Michael well for their term.

"Declan Ryan was manager of the Tipperary minor hurling team in 2007 when they won the All-Ireland title. Tommy Dunne was coach and Michael Gleeson was a selector. Tommy Dunne was coach to the Tipperary U-21 team which won this year's All Ireland title and was also manager of the Toomevara senior hurling team this year.

"Michael Gleeson managed Thurles Sarsfields to victory in the Tipperary senior hurling championship in 2009 and 2010 and has also managed Thurles Sarsfields minor teams to win county titles in both hurling and football.

"Declan Ryan won three All-Ireland senior hurling medals with Tipperary in 1989, 1991 and 2001. He played 41 championship games for Tipperary between 1988 and 2001, scoring 9-64 in 26 wins, 4 draws and 11 defeats. He represented Tipperary at minor and under 21 levels and captained the U-21 team to win Munster and All-Ireland titles in 1989.

"He also won four national hurling league medals, five Munster senior hurling champonship medals, two All-Star awards and two county senior hurling championship medals with his club, Clonoulty Rossmore, in 1989 and 1997.

"Tommy Dunne captained Tipperary to win the All-Ireland senior hurling title in 2001 and was named hurler of the year in 2001. He played 44 championship games for Tipperary between 1993 and 2005, scoring 6-109 in 24 wins, four draws and 16 defeats. He won an All-Ireland U-21 hurling medal in 1995 and also represented Tipperary at minor in 1991 and '92.

He won 10 Tipperary county senior hurling championships with his club, Toomevara, including two as captain, and three Munster club championship medals. He also won three national hurling league medals, two as captain, two Munster senior hurling championship medals, a Munster minor championship medal and three All-Star awards. "

Michael Gleeson played senior hurling for Tipperary against Clare in the 1977 Munster senior hurling championship. He also played in the 1975/76 and 76/77 national hurling league. He played senior hurling with Thurles Sarsfields for 10 years between 1974 and 1983, winning a county championship medal in 1974 and three Mid division senior hurling medals.

"He began his career in team management with the Durlas Óg club in Thurles and has made a major contribution to the recent revival in the fortunes of Thurles Sarsfields at underage and adult level."
